Austin Airport’s New TSA Checkpoint: A Game-Changer for Travelers

Introduction

Austin-Bergstrom International Airport (AUS) has completed its business creation venture ahead of schedule, unveiling a brand-new TSA checkpoint that promises to revolutionize the travel experience for passengers. This significant development marks a major milestone in the airport’s ongoing efforts to enhance security, improve efficiency, and accommodate the growing number of travelers passing through its terminals.

Background

Austin-Bergstrom International Airport has been experiencing rapid growth in recent years, with passenger numbers increasing steadily. This surge in travelers has put pressure on the airport’s infrastructure, particularly in terms of security checkpoints and passenger processing. To address these challenges, the airport management initiated a business creation venture aimed at expanding and improving the existing facilities.

The project, which was initially slated for completion in late 2026, has been finished ahead of schedule, demonstrating the efficiency and dedication of the airport’s management and construction teams. Practical Advice

For travelers planning to use Austin-Bergstrom International Airport, here are some practical tips to make the most of the new TSA checkpoint:

1. Arrive early: While the new checkpoint is designed to improve efficiency, it’s always wise to arrive at the airport with plenty of time before your flight, especially during peak travel periods.

2. Familiarize yourself with TSA guidelines: Stay up-to-date with the latest TSA regulations regarding carry-on items, liquids, and electronics to ensure a smooth screening process.

3. Consider TSA PreCheck: If you’re a frequent traveler, enrolling in TSA PreCheck can further expedite your screening process at Austin-Bergstrom International Airport and other participating airports.

4. Utilize mobile apps: Download the airport’s official app or other travel apps to stay informed about security wait times and any potential delays.

5. Pack strategically: Organize your carry-on items in a way that makes it easy to remove laptops, liquids, and other items that may need separate screening.
